Dr. LeBlanc is the father of Sherry LeBlanc and husband of Mrs. LeBlanc. Both he and his wife were murdered by the mysterious organization of Iliaster, to acquire the special Z-One card he had designed. He had discovered what Iliaster had been up to using the Infinity device. Clark Smith, the president of Momentum Express Development Organization, was then responsible for allowing he and his wife's murder. In the dub version they are instead kidnapped by Iliaster and sent to a currently unknown secret location, though it's implied that they were also killed in the dub.

DR.LeBlanc, dead.

Dr. LeBlanc, shot dead by agents of Iliaster.(This is cut from the English anime)

Ad blocker interference detected!

Wikia is a free-to-use site that makes money from advertising. We have a modified experience for viewers using ad blockers

Wikia is not accessible if you’ve made further modifications. Remove the custom ad blocker rule(s) and the page will load as expected.